9 videos • 51 views • by TheGamerBay LetsPlay Rayman: Raving Rabbids is a party video game developed and published by Ubisoft for multiple platforms including the Wii, PlayStation 2, Xbox 360, and PC. It was released in 2006 as a spin-off of the popular Rayman series. The game follows Rayman, a limbless hero, as he is captured by the mischievous and insane Rabbids – white, rabbit-like creatures with an insatiable appetite for chaos. The Rabbids have taken over Rayman's world and are planning to invade Earth. In order to save his home and himself, Rayman must compete in a series of minigames to entertain the Rabbids and distract them long enough for him to find a way to escape. The game features over 70 minigames, each with a unique and wacky theme. These minigames range from racing and dancing to shooting and sports, and can be played in single player or multiplayer mode. The multiplayer mode allows up to four players to compete against each other in split-screen or online. One of the unique features of Rayman: Raving Rabbids is the use of the Wii's motion controls. Players use the Wii Remote and Nunchuk to control the minigames, making the gameplay more interactive and immersive. In addition to the main minigame mode, there is also a story mode where players must complete challenges to progress through four different worlds and eventually confront the Rabbids' leader in a final showdown. The game's graphics and soundtrack are colorful and playful, adding to the overall fun and chaotic atmosphere. The Rabbids themselves are known for their silly and comical behavior, making the game enjoyable for players of all ages. Rayman: Raving Rabbids received positive reviews for its entertaining minigames, unique use of motion controls, and humorous storyline. It spawned several sequels and spin-offs, solidifying its place as a beloved party game among gamers.
